Understanding the Importance of Website Development Kansas City
In an increasingly digital world, having a well-designed website is essential for businesses to thrive. This is particularly true for companies looking to establish or grow their presence in Kansas City. Website development kansas city is not just about creating a digital presence; it’s about crafting an engaging user experience that is reflective of local values and needs.
The Role of Local Identity in Web Development
Local identity plays a crucial role in web development, especially in a diverse city like Kansas City. Websites should resonate with the local community, culture, and business environment. When users feel a connection with a brand, they are more likely to engage with it. This can be achieved through the use of local imagery, references to local events, and content that speaks to the unique characteristics of Kansas City. Authenticity is key—showcasing your local identity can differentiate your brand from competitors and foster trust among potential customers.
How Website Development Impacts Business Growth
The right website can be a powerful catalyst for business growth. A well-developed site serves as a 24/7 storefront that can attract customers and generate leads without needing direct supervision. By optimizing the website for search engines and ensuring that it remains user-friendly, businesses can significantly improve their visibility and reach. Moreover, a site that reflects the professionalism and quality of a business can enhance credibility, leading to increased conversions and ultimately, revenue growth.
Identifying Target Audience Through Effective Web Design
Understanding your target audience is foundational to effective website development. This involves more than just demographics; it requires insights into their preferences, behaviors, and pain points. By employing effective web design techniques, such as user personas and customer journey mapping, businesses can create tailored experiences that guide users smoothly towards taking desired actions, whether that’s making a purchase, signing up for a newsletter, or contacting customer service.
Core Elements of Successful Website Development Kansas City
User-Centric Design Principles
User-centric design is centered around the needs and experiences of the user. Creating a website that prioritizes user expectations can lead to better engagement rates. The following principles should be observed:
- Usability: Ensure that every element of the website is intuitive. This includes clear navigation, accessible content, and logically structured information.
- Visual Design: The visual appeal of a site contributes significantly to its user engagement. Utilizing color psychology and effective typography can enhance user retention.
- Accessibility: Designing for accessibility ensures that all users, including those with disabilities, can interact with the site. This includes alt text for images and keyboard navigation options.
Responsive Design for All Devices
With the increasing variety of devices used to browse the web, responsive design has become essential. A responsive website adjusts seamlessly to varying screen sizes, providing an optimal viewing experience regardless of the device in use. This adaptability not only enhances user satisfaction but also positively impacts search engine rankings. Google prioritizes mobile-friendly websites in search results, making it critical for businesses to invest in responsive design.
SEO Best Practices in Web Development
Search engine optimization (SEO) is an integral part of website development. Implementing SEO best practices can help businesses increase their online visibility. Key practices include:
- Keyword Research: Identifying relevant keywords that potential customers are searching for can guide content creation.
- On-page SEO: Optimize page titles, meta descriptions, and headers with relevant keywords while maintaining a natural flow.
- Quality Content: Creating valuable, informative, and engaging content keeps users on the site longer and encourages repeat visits.
Critical Challenges in Website Development Kansas City
Overcoming Limited Budgets and Resources
One of the most significant challenges businesses face in website development is budget constraints. Limited resources can affect the quality of design, functionality, and marketing efforts. To mitigate this, businesses can:
- Prioritize Features: Focus on developing essential features first and then phase in additional functionalities over time.
- Use Templates: Utilizing website builders or templates can significantly reduce costs while still allowing for customization.
- Outsource Wisely: If certain aspects of development require expertise beyond the team’s capabilities, consider outsourcing these components to improve quality without the need for hiring full-time staff.
Navigating Technical Issues in Development
Technical issues can arise during the website development process, ranging from server errors to coding bugs. Proper planning and a clear communication channel can help manage these risks. Regular testing throughout the development phase is essential in identifying and resolving potential problems early on, thus saving time and resources in the long run.
Managing Client Expectations Effectively
It’s vital to establish clear communication with clients to manage expectations during the website development process. Detailed project timelines, deliverables, and any limitations should be outlined upfront to avoid later misunderstandings. Regular updates can help reassure clients and provide opportunities for feedback, fostering a collaborative environment that ultimately leads to satisfaction on both sides.
Tools and Technologies for Website Development Kansas City
Essential Software for Development Projects
Choosing the right tools is crucial for efficient website development. A variety of software options exist, including:
- Design Software: Tools such as Adobe XD or Figma are invaluable for creating design prototypes.
- Development Frameworks: Frameworks like React or Angular speed up the development process and enhance functionality.
- Content Management Systems: Platforms like WordPress provide flexible options for building and maintaining websites with minimal technical know-how.
Choosing the Right Content Management Systems
The choice of content management system (CMS) can greatly impact how easily a website can be updated, maintained, and optimized. Factors to consider when choosing a CMS include:
- User-Friendliness: Select a platform that your team can navigate easily to update content without extensive training.
- Scalability: The CMS should be able to grow with your business, accommodating additional features as needed.
- SEO Capabilities: Choose a CMS that supports SEO best practices, allowing you to optimize the site effectively.
Leveraging Analytics for Performance Improvement
Analytics tools are essential for understanding how users interact with your website. They provide data on user behavior, allowing businesses to make informed decisions for improvement. Setting up tools like Google Analytics can help track key performance indicators such as page views, bounce rates, and conversion rates. Regularly analyzing this data enables businesses to tweak their strategies, ensuring continual enhancement of user experience and website effectiveness.
Measuring Success in Website Development Kansas City
Key Performance Indicators for Websites
Measuring the success of a website involves tracking various key performance indicators (KPIs), including:
- Traffic Levels: Evaluating organic, direct, and referral traffic helps understand where users are coming from.
- Conversion Rates: The percentage of visitors who take the desired action, whether it’s filling out a form or making a purchase.
- Average Session Duration: This metric reflects how engaging and relevant users find the site content.
Feedback Mechanisms to Enhance User Experience
Collecting user feedback is crucial in enhancing website performance. Implementing tools such as user surveys, feedback forms, or live chat options can provide valuable insights into user satisfaction. Listening to user feedback helps identify pain points and areas for improvement, ensuring the website remains user-friendly and effective.
Long-term Maintenance and Upgradation Strategies
Website development doesn’t stop after the site goes live. Long-term maintenance is vital to ensure the website continues to function optimally and remains secure. This includes regular updates to software and plugins, assessing the site’s performance, and keeping content fresh and relevant. Establishing a long-term strategy for upgrades will ensure the website evolves in line with changing user preferences and technological advancements.